This manifest lists 22 enslaved people who were boarded onto a steamship named Galveston which was captained by John T. Wright. These people were claimed as chattel property by a Samuel Mills of Texas. They embarked from New Orleans to Galveston on February 9, 1846. The Port of Galveston is the port of the city of Galveston, Texas. It was established by a proclamation issued by the Congress of Mexico on October 17, 1825, while the land known today as Texas was still part of Mexico. The ...The Galveston Island Ferry provides free transportation between Galveston Island and Bolivar Peninsula. Two vessels are available to transport passengers, with one vessel operating 24 hours a day and the second operating from 6:30 a.m. During the summer and holidays, up to five vessels may operate based on traffic volumes.Compare flight deals to New Orleans from Galveston from over 1,000 providers. The Algiers Ferry via Canal Street crosses the Mississippi River and highlights a ...The Free Port Aransas Ferry runs 24 hours, 7 days a week. The route runs up to six ferries a day and connects travelers on SH 361 a link across the Corpus Christi Channel between Aransas Pass, on the mainland, and Port Aransas, on Mustang Island. The quarter-mile route typically takes less than ten minutes, although peak summer hours may require drivers to wait longer.
